What is Double Glazing?Double glazing consists of 2 separate panes of glass that are sealed together with an airtight area between them. Usually, this area is filled with an inert gas, often argon or krypton, which enhances insulation by decreasing heat transfer.
Secret Components of Double Glazing
Panes of Glass: Usually made from tempered or laminated glass, these panels are created to hold up against different environmental conditions.
Spacer Bar: Placed in between the two panes, this product preserves the area and supports them, typically made from products like aluminum or composite products.
Sealing: The edges of the glass panes are sealed with a long lasting sealant to avoid moisture and impurities from getting in the area between the panes.
Inert Gas: The area in between the panes is typically filled with argon, krypton, or xenon gas, which supplies better insulation compared to air.

Benefits of Double Glazing Technology The setup of double-glazed windows has various advantages that can significantly boost the living experience and ecological footprint of a building.
Energy Efficiency
- Lowered Heat Loss: Double glazing significantly decreases the amount of heat leaving a building, causing lower heating costs in winter season.
- Boosted Insulation: The inert gas between the glass panes functions as an insulator, keeping homes cooler in summer season and warmer in winter.
Sound Reduction
- Sound Insulation: The style of double glazing assists to reduce outside sound, making it an excellent choice for homes in hectic or city locations.
Condensation Control
- Decreased Condensation: The temperature level difference in between the inside and outdoors panes is decreased, which lowers condensation buildup.
Increased Security
- Strengthened Glass: Double-glazed windows are typically more difficult to break, making homes more secure.
Ecological Benefits
- Lower Carbon Footprint: Reducing the requirement for heating and cooling reduces greenhouse gas emissions.
Visual Appeal
- Variety of Designs: Double-glazed windows been available in various styles and styles, providing aesthetic appeals and performance.
Understanding the different kinds of double glazing can help house owners select the best option for their requirements.
1. Basic Double Glazing
- Description: This is the most common kind, including two panes of glass that offer a standard level of insulation.
2. Low-E (Low Emissivity) Glass
- Description: This glass has a special finishing that shows heat back inside, improving energy efficiency.
3. Acoustic Double Glazing
- Description: Designed for sound decrease, this type utilizes thicker or laminated glass to reduce sound transmission.
4. Triple Glazing
- Description: Although not technically double glazing, this variation uses three panes of glass offering even greater thermal performance.

- Structure Regulations: Check regional building regulations as they might dictate specific requirements for window installations.
- Frame Type: The type of frame you pick (uPVC, wood, aluminum) will affect both aesthetics and insulation homes.
- Setup Quality: Proper fitting by a qualified professional ensures optimum performance.
Installation Process
- Site Assessment: An expert assesses the existing windows and recommends suitable replacements.
- Window Selection: Choose the ideal type of double glazing based on energy needs and visual choices.
- Removal of Old Windows: The old frames must be carefully removed to prevent damage to the surrounding location.
- Installation of New Windows: The new double-glazed systems are fitted, making sure appropriate sealing to take full advantage of insulation.
- Last Checks: After setup, professionals look for any gaps or insulation concerns.
Q1: Is double glazing worth the investment?A1: Yes, while the preliminary
expense is higher, the long-lasting savings on energy expenses and increased comfort often justify the financial investment. Q2: Can I replace single glazing with double glazing myself?A2: It is extremely advised to hire experts for double
glazing setup to guarantee optimum performance and adherence to security requirements. Q3: How long does double glazing last?A3: With correct care, double-glazed windows can last anywhere from 20 to 35 years. Q4: What upkeep is required for double-glazed windows?A4: Regular cleaning and examination of seals will help keep the effectiveness of double glazing. Q5: Will double glazing remove all noise?A5: While double glazing significantly decreases sound, it might not eliminate it totally, particularly if it is incredibly loud exterior.
